Technology Consultant Intern applicants have rated the interview process at EY with 3 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 75% positive. To compare, the company-average is 74.2%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Technology Consultant Intern roles take an average of 22 days to get hired, when considering 16 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at EY overall takes an average of 30 days.
Common stages of the interview process at EY as a Technology Consultant Intern according to 16 Glassdoor interviews include:
One on one interview: 31%
Skills test: 25%
Personality test: 19%
Phone interview: 16%
Background check: 6%
Presentation: 3%

I applied online. The process took 2 weeks. I interviewed at EY (New York, NY) in Mar 2022
Interview
It was a very positive experience: I had 3 interviews back to back which lasted 3 hours. The first was a case study interview (on a data model and adding updates to native and web-based mobile applications), the second was a behavioral, and the third was a mix of data science and behavioral questions.
The interviews depend on an individual's course work and interests
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
1) Privacy and quality of data models?
2) How do you know that a visual of data is wrong or manipulative?
3) How would you improve the communication between two businesses?
4) General behavioral questions like "tell me about a time you had to come up with an innovative solution?"
I applied online. The process took 4 weeks. I interviewed at EY (Atlanta, GA) in Oct 2025
Interview
Behavioral + Case study interview. Behavioral consisted of normal questions about yourself and what you would if put in particular situations. Case study was about a company looking to integrate AI.
The interview process was really direct and to the point. However, it was also very conversational and informal. It flowed like a conversation, so be prepared. There were 2 portions, a technical and behavioral interview back to back.
I applied online. The process took 4 weeks. I interviewed at EY (Dublin, Dublin) in Mar 2025
Interview
Very relaxed mostly behavioural questions and 1 basic technical question (what is a pointer and how does it work?) They seemed more focus on soft skills and your overall vibe if you’re easy to work with.
